What Being Two Isn't Easy is
Kon Ichikawa, master of the widescreen domestic drama, turns his eye to the terrible twos. A small boy approaches his second birthday, much to the consternation of his parents. It's a rare comedy from the director, but still manages to wring pathos from its simple premise.
